I would ask if an accident report or accident information exchange forms were ever completed.
You have to understand why the police "didn't do anything" which is because an accident is not a "criminal" matter but an issue handled by the insurance companies.
If there were any "criminal" events that occurred such as drunkenness then the officers would be able to do more.
I don't want to be misunderstood and it be thought I don't think this is a bad situation where a driver has been involved in two accidents within a weeks time...but this is a civil not criminal issue!
*** Again...I certainly understand your anger. OK...he was also speeding! The speeding is a violation! For an officer to issue a traffic summons he must witness the event himself.
An officer may make an arrest when he witnesses a violation, misdemeanor, or felony occurring in his presence. He cannot make an arrest if he did not witness a violation or misdemeanor. If he witnessed or has reason to believe a felony was committed...he can make an arrest for a felony offense even if he did not witness it!
If the violator was speeding, whomever witnesses the speeding offense can file a traffic complaint and have the driver arrested. The problem is...not many citizens want to go out of their way to make time for such complaints thinking the cops will eventually catch them. The problem is with our population growing and our economy declining...governments can't employ the number of sworn officers needed....anywhere!
In my job...I depend heavily on the community to be my eyes and ears. I listen to the public and respond as best that I can to their issues...provided another priority call isn't waiting first. |
